platinichloric
<chemistry> Of, pertaining to, or designating, an acid consisting of platinic chloride and hydrochloric acid, and obtained as a brownish red crystalline substance, called platinichloric, or chloroplatinic, acid.

windle noun1. Now dial.
[Old English windel, from windan WIND verb1 + -LE3.]
A basket. OE.
A measure of corn etc., usu. equal to about 3 bushels. local. ME.
A bundle of straw etc. Scot. E19.
